WebOct 28, 2024 · So, LLCs can own a C Corp, but not an S Corp. If an LLC owns shares in a C Corp, the C Corp will be taxed as a corporation, but any dividends passed to the LLC and its members will then be subject to individual taxes on the members' personal tax returns.
